#205b01 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#205b01 is composed of 12.5% red, 35.7%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.9% yellow and 64.3% black. It has a hue angle of 99.3 degrees, a saturation of 97.8% and a lightness of 18%. #205b01 color hex could be obtained by blending #40b602 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

● #205b01 color description : Very dark green.
#205b01 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#205b01 has RGB values of R:32, G:91,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 2120449.
